Abstract

Abstract

En 中文
• A new framework jointly models commit messages, code diffs, and changed semantics. • Changed semantics capture added and deleted content identified from ASTs. • CMD reduces reliance on commit messages during the training. • The method remains robust when commit messages are missing. • The method achieves leading performance on two public security patch datasets.
